Lines Matching defs:node
30 /* initialize the head to check whether a node is inserted */
31 RB_CLEAR_NODE(&t->node);
45 this = container_of(*new, struct alarm_block, node);
54 rb_link_node(&alarm->node, parent, new);
55 rb_insert_color(&alarm->node, &alarm_root);
72 /* don't remove a non-inserted node */
73 if (!RB_EMPTY_NODE(&alarm->node)) {
74 rb_erase(&alarm->node, &alarm_root);
75 RB_CLEAR_NODE(&alarm->node);
81 if (RB_EMPTY_NODE(&alarm->node))
108 struct rb_node *node;
113 node = rb_first(&alarm_root);
114 if (node) {
116 this = container_of(node, struct alarm_block, node);
126 struct rb_node *node;
133 for (node = rb_first(&alarm_root); node; node = rb_next(node)) {
134 this = container_of(node, struct alarm_block, node);
144 rb_erase(&this->node, &alarm_root);
145 RB_CLEAR_NODE(&this->node);